Breaking Down Social Security Disability Lawyer Assistance

Social Security Disability law includes two primary federal programs — Social Security Disability Insurance , known as SSDI, and Supplemental Security Income , known as SSI,. SSDI is available to people who have contributed to Social Security over a working lifetime, while SSI supports those with low income and few assets. A social security disability lawyer guides individuals through whichever program applies depending on their specific needs.

The process from the start of a claim to a successful outcome can involve multiple rounds of review. Claims move through several levels, including initial review, the reconsideration phase, ALJ hearings, and federal court appeals. A social security disability lawyer familiar with each of these levels can identify where key arguments can make the difference.

This legal field is particularly important to people living with a wide range of disabilities, from orthopedic conditions and cardiovascular disease to psychological conditions such as depression, anxiety, and PTSD. No matter the diagnosis, the right legal advocate can present the most compelling argument.

Social Security Disability Lawyer FAQ

What is the usual timeline for an SSD case?

Processing time varies considerably depending on where your case stands. First-time filings usually get a determination within 90 to 180 days, but many are denied. If your application proceeds to an ALJ hearing, the timeline can mean another 12 months or more. Having a social security disability lawyer from the start can help avoid unnecessary delays.

What are the fees for a disability attorney?

Social security disability lawyers generally work on a no-win-no-fee arrangement, which means there are no upfront costs unless your case is won. The SSA regulates attorney fees at a federally regulated maximum, with a hard cap of $7,200 as of current regulations. This means hiring a lawyer available to most applicants.

Which disabilities does the SSA recognize?

The SSA uses a Blue Book of qualifying conditions — widely known as the "Blue Book" — that outlines qualifying medical conditions. These include spinal and orthopedic impairments, cardiac impairments, brain and nervous system disorders, mental health disorders, immune deficiencies, and malignant tumors, among others. A social security disability lawyer can assess your medical situation to identify whether you meet a listed disability or can succeed under a medical-vocational approach.

Can I appeal after multiple denials?

Yes — a denial at any stage is not the end. The appeals process includes a second review, hearings before an administrative law judge, Appeals Council review, and ultimately U.S. District Court. Many individuals are approved at the ALJ hearing stage even after being turned down more than once. Our social security disability lawyer professionals manages every level of the process.

SSDI vs. SSI — which program is right for me?

SSDI — Social Security Disability Insurance — is based on your work credits accumulated over time. SSI — Supplemental Security Income — is a needs-based program for those with minimal assets and income. A number of people are eligible for both programs simultaneously. A social security disability lawyer can evaluate which benefit applies to your case — and in some cases pursue both on your behalf.
